Talent Watch – Mania Zamani

Having grown up in Tehran, Mania Zamani’s life has been deeply entrenched in Persian tradition. Her subsequent move to New York saw her delve into a more creative world: Mania studied gemology and jewelry design at GIA and further honed her skills in jewelry design at the Fashion Institute of Technology. Architectural, modern, and harmonious is how best one can describe Mania’s signature design aesthetics that continue to draw upon her multi-cultural background. She started her eponymous line in 2013 with one-of-a-kind high-jewelry pieces, which she sold mainly to private clients. In 2014, she launched her first collection, Unity, followed by East/West in 2016. “I wanted to create architecturally inspired, modern jewelry which is highly viable,” says the designer. The Unity collection – captures through its designs – Mania’s ardent passion for mathematics, realization of the universal and sacred nature of geometry, and transcultural architectural forms. “As far as the East/West collection is concerned, I look to the world from both an eastern and a western perspective, and to the design history from yesterday through today and tomorrow,” says Mania, who is busy putting together her design book.
